What to Know About Ogu / Obolo
Key Facts
Ogu is a town and the administrative headquarters of Ogu-Bolo Local Government Area in Rivers State, Nigeria. Located in the southern part of the Niger Delta region, Ogu sits along the banks of the Sombreiro River, approximately 25 kilometers southeast of Port Harcourt, the state capital. This coastal settlement occupies a strategic position within the Ogu-Bolo LGA, serving as a central hub for the surrounding communities. With an estimated population of around 40,000 people, Ogu covers an area of approximately 85 square kilometers of predominantly wetland terrain characterized by mangrove swamps and freshwater ecosystems. The town is divided into several traditional quarters and neighborhoods that reflect its historical development pattern. As the administrative center, Ogu hosts the local government secretariat and serves as the primary service delivery point for the entire Ogu-Bolo Local Government Area. The town's economy is predominantly based on fishing, farming, and petty trading, with increasing involvement in the oil and gas service industry due to its proximity to major oil installations. Ogu maintains strong cultural ties with the neighboring Obolo community, sharing linguistic and traditional practices that date back centuries.
